Has anyone tried Palmolive's dish liquid in Coconut Water and Jasmine? "Experience the delightful scent of refreshing coconut water and comforting jasmine in your kitchen and enjoy radiant and fresh clean dishes! Palmolive Ultra Coconut Water & Jasmine Dishwashing Detergent's concentrated liquid dish soap formula is tough on grease, yet soft on hands." $1.99 for 591 ml at Target, where you'll also find the same product in Lavender & Lime. (And Target doesn't seem to have it, but there is also a Passion Fruit & Mandarin.)

Maison La Bougie candles are marked down for final sale at Beautyhabit. Shown is my favorite design, Rose des Vents ("Subtly fresh with thyme, this departure gives way to bergamot with a unique delicacy. In a bright, spring-like opening, the pines warm the bodies in heliotropic shades as the freshness of the vanilla balances perfectly.") It is $100 for 300g. The regular 190g candles in glass jars without lids (including a cute one for Paul & Joe, complete with kitty) are all $44.

Cire Trudon Salta candle ~ home fragrance review

Posted by Kevin on 13 January 2020 12 Comments

Considered by the Chinese as one of the three holy fruits with peach and lemon, the grapefruit was a symbol of prosperity and fertility. Also highly prized by the Greeks and the Romans, the hesperide has a crisp freshness: known for its rich terroir and unique soil, the Salta region enhances the citrus’ intensity. Blended with verbena and hyacinth, the grapefruit fragrance is aromatic. ~ Cire Trudon

In those three sentences, Cire Trudon references Italy, Greece, China and…Argentina (its beautiful Salta region does produce citrus…but is more well known for its lemons)…

The latest fragrance from Mrs. Meyer's: Rose. "Rose, a beloved garden bloom made modern for Spring. Touches of crisp green apple and pulpy stone fruits all sprinkled with watery freshness by any other name, still a rose." Available in Dish Soap, Hand Soap, Multi-Surface Cleaner and Room Freshener spray.

A new Diptyque limited edition candle for Eau Capitale: "From the Eau Capitale Paris En Fleurs Collection. For this celebration of Paris, Diptyque draws its inspiration from the rose and its many variations: like the roses of Bagatelle or the roses you’d find in a flower market. To create this scent, Diptyque collaborated with artist and friend, Pierre Marie. Together, they brought to life a fragrance inspired by Art Nouveau- a fragrant trellis on which rustic foliage and roses intermingle." In 70g mini ($38) or 190g full ($74), at Saks.
